摘要

Lithium perchlorate solutions in nitromethane, have been investigated usingattenuated total reflection Fourier-transform infrared (ATR FTIR) spectroscopy. Despite the relatively poor electron-donating ability of nitromethane, some evidence for lithium ion coordination is seen.
